A compelling, wrenching and exposing performance journey, led by an enquiring wretch, who says and does the unsayable, the undoable. His grasp and love of language is poetic, brilliant, haunting and forces us to think - why does a memory you want to hang on to keep changing, why does love tear you up? Gari Jones has directed Accidental Death of An Anarchist, The Lonesome West, Depot, Under Milk Wood and A Slight Ache and The Lover for the Mercury Theatre Company. Suitable for 16+ years. Contains scenes and language some people may find disturbing.
